Great and really useful review, I bought this version Sora 700c at a great sale price in the UK a few months ago - I live in a very hilly part of the UK, so as a very cheap instant way of lowering gear inches I fitted a Shimano HG200 11 -36 cassette which the Sora rear derailleur handles no problem, I also fitted 50mm Schwable G-one Ultrabite tyres which I enjoy riding off road/on rail trails. I have got a SunRace 11 - 40, 9 speed cassette to try as forums indicate this works and others I have read recommend a RoadLink so that the rear derailleur can handle it. Anyway I like the robustness of the 9 speed Sora groupset and I think it is a loss that 9 speed CUES will not necessarily replace when the drop bar version comes out and I think it will be hydraulic only, and whilst I value the hydraulic brakes on my mountain bikes I don't need them for my road/gravel bike - so when the Sora wears out I might replace it with Microshift Sword either 10 speed or 9 speed. I just picked up a used 21' Talon E+ 3 29er for my 70 year old father. I think it should be a GREAT bike for him! Word to the wise - it's probably worth getting the manufacturer's app and investigating the bike more before proceeding with purchase (or have the current owner send it to you.) Reason I say this - is the used Talon E+ I just bought supposedly had "250 miles to school and back" allegedly according to the seller. She was the mother of the owner, and it has been several years since purchase so I'll give her that .. Pull up the app however when I got home, and the data shows the bike has been ridden 1100 miles! Quite a bit of difference which would have certainly affected the final sale price. Always do your homework!
